Re-evaluating Vehicle Priorities & Financial Trade-offs

The core discussion revolves around a family’s financial situation and the need to balance current vehicle preferences with future goals, specifically the desire to have another child and potentially have one parent stay at home. The current financial reality is that the family’s most valuable vehicle – a Tacoma truck valued at approximately $30,000 – is being used as a daily commuter, which is financially inefficient. The speaker argues that the “nicest car” should logically be the family automobile, not the commuter vehicle.

Proposed Solution: Vehicle Role Reversal

The proposed solution centers on a role reversal for the existing vehicles. The speaker suggests utilizing the $30,000 Tacoma truck as the primary family vehicle and transitioning to a less expensive, “beater” vehicle for daily commuting. This is presented not as an ideal scenario, but as a necessary trade-off to free up financial resources. The speaker acknowledges the emotional attachment to the truck ("that definitely is my baby") but emphasizes the need for practical financial considerations.

The Importance of Creative Thinking & Temporary Adjustments

The speaker stresses the importance of “thinking really really creatively and thinking outside the box” when facing significant life goals. They emphasize that current financial circumstances are not fixed and that “the way that your financial life and the way your life looks today does not dictate how it must look tomorrow.” This is framed as a “seasonal” solution, implying that the arrangement is not intended to be permanent. The speaker frames the necessary sacrifices as “intense” but acknowledges the “wonderful, amazing, noble” nature of the goals driving these changes (having another child, a stay-at-home parent).
